Charlize Theron (born 7 August 1975) is a South African and American actress and film producer. "Snow White" is a 19th-century German fairy tale which is today known widely across the Western world.

Snow White and the Huntsman

Snow White and the Huntsman is a 2012 American fantasy film based on the German fairy tale "Snow White" compiled by the Brothers Grimm.

The Huntsman: Winter's War

The Huntsman: Winter's War is a 2016 American fantasy adventure film, both a prequel and sequel to Snow White and the Huntsman (2012), it takes place before and after the events of the first film.
